Course Details

• Understanding Inclusion and Diversity in HR: An Overview
• Developing an Inclusive Hiring Strategy
• Creating an Inclusive Workplace Culture
• Managing Diverse Teams: Best Practices
• Addressing Unconscious Bias in HR Practices
• Designing Inclusive Training and Development Programs
• Implementing Inclusive Employee Benefits and Policies
• Measuring and Evaluating Inclusion and Diversity Initiatives
• Legal and Compliance Considerations in HR Inclusion Planning

HR Manager: With an average salary ranging from £35,000 to £60,000, HR Managers are responsible for managing and leading their organization's human resources functions. 2. HR Specialist: HR Specialists, earning between £25,000 and £40,000, are experts in specific HR areas, such as recruitment, employee relations, or compensation and benefits. 3. Diversity & Inclusion Specialist: This role focuses on fostering a diverse and inclusive work environment, with salaries ranging from £28,000 to £45,000. 4. HR Analyst: HR Analysts, earning between £22,000 and £35,000, are responsible for analyzing HR data and providing insights to support strategic decision-making. 5. Recruitment Officer: With an average salary of £22,000 to £30,000, Recruitment Officers manage their organization's recruitment process, ensuring the best talent is hired. 6. Training & Development Officer: Earning between £20,000 and £30,000, Training & Development Officers design and implement learning programs to enhance employee skills and performance. 7.
